Battery Management Systems (BMS) are essential components in modern electric vehicles and portable devices. They ensure the safety, longevity, and performance of batteries, directly impacting the device’s range and reliability.
What is a Battery Management System?
A Battery Management System is an electronic system that monitors and manages the operation of a battery pack. It oversees parameters such as voltage, current, temperature, and state of charge to prevent damage and optimize performance.
The Importance of BMS in Maintaining Range
One of the primary roles of a BMS is to ensure the battery operates within safe limits. By accurately monitoring the battery’s health, it prevents overcharging and deep discharging, which can degrade battery capacity over time. This management helps maintain a consistent range, especially in electric vehicles where range anxiety is a concern.
Balancing Cells for Optimal Performance
The BMS balances individual cells within a battery pack. This process ensures all cells have equal charge levels, preventing one weak cell from limiting overall performance. Proper balancing extends battery life and maintains a stable range.
Temperature Regulation
Temperature fluctuations can significantly affect battery capacity. The BMS manages thermal conditions by activating cooling or heating systems, ensuring the battery remains within optimal temperature ranges. This regulation helps preserve range consistency during different driving or usage conditions.
